Leann:

One squashed bug!  In Synaptic, I marked the kernel 2.6.27.11 for 
"re-installation" and then clicked "Apply".

I then re-booted my computer and it booted into 2.6.27.11 just as it 
should without any incident.

Thanks for the suggestion, it was right-on as a a solution to fix my 
computer.

John
